PITTSBURGH (KDKA) — The president of Allegheny County Council said whistleblowers contacted him with allegations of poor construction of the new parking garage at Pittsburgh International Airport.

The Allegheny County Airport Authority, though, said any safety concerns are unfounded and it has identified solutions for cosmetic hairline cracks.

Allegheny County Council President Patrick Catena said he was sent several pictures and a video showing cracks in the floors of a parking garage that’s being built at Pittsburgh International Airport. According to Catena, a handful of people reached out to him with concerns about the quality of work being done, fearing it would be swept under the rug if it wasn’t made public.

“There are allegations that the principal contractor for the parking garage – Michael Baker International, Inc. – is aware that the condition of the parking decks in the garage is of substandard quality. There are also allegations that Baker has directed a subcontractor – Rycon Construction, Inc. – to apply a coating to the parking decks to conceal the quality issues, rather than fixing them,” Catena said.
